Despite Protests, US Base to Stay on Japan's Okinawa
(May 28) -- A U.S. Marine base will stay on the Japanese island of Okinawa despite deep opposition by locals, according to a joint statement today by the U.S. and Japan that sought to convey stability as tensions escalate on the neighboring Korean peninsula. Marines Leave Okinawa: U.S. To Remove 9,000 Stationed On Japanese Island (VIDEO)
About 9,000 U.S. Marines stationed on the Japanese island of Okinawa will be moved to the U.S. territory of Guam and other locations in the Asia-Pacific, including Hawaii, under a U.S.-Japan agreement announced Thursday.
